Austrian Town That Inspired Frozen Puts Up Fence To Block Tourist Selfies

Article Featured Image

A scenic town called Hallstatt, tucked away in the Austrian mountains, is said to have inspired Disney’s hit movie Frozen, and draws thousands of tourists each year to marvel and take selfies.

However, the residents and mayor of Hallstatt are fed up with people flogging the area for pictures and have erected a wooden fence on a popular selfie spot.

It has since been removed after backlash on social media, but the mayor of Hallstatt hopes that it would send a message to disruptive tourists coming to soak in the views.

Instead, Mayor Alexander Scheutz said that he wants to put a banner in the area to remind tourists to be respectful of residents.

The Austrian destination,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, has already introduced measures to curb “overtourism”, including a daily limit of buses and cars allowed to enter.
